Motronic MP 9.0 injection and ignition system
Self diagnosis
Interrogating and erasing fault memory

Special tools, testers and auxiliary items

  • ◆ Fault reader V.A.G 1551 with cable V.A.G 1551/3

Note:

The vehicle system tester V.A.G 1552 can be used instead of fault reader V.A.G 1551, however a print-out is then not possible.

Work sequence

  • ‒ Connect fault reader V.A.G 1551 and select engine electronics control unit (address word 01); selection is carried out with engine idling.

Only when engine does not start:

  • ‒ Switch on ignition.
  • ‒ Switch on printer with the Print Key
    (Warning lamp in key lights up)
 
→ Indicated on display:
Rapid data transfer     HELP
Select function XX
  • ‒ Operate fault reader taking into account the information on the display:
  • ‒ Input 02 for "Interrogate full memory" function and confirm with Q.
 
→ The number of faults stored or "No fault recognised!" will be shown on the display.
X Faults reconised!

Note

If something different is indicated on the display:

=> Fault reader operating instructions

If no fault is stored

  • ‒ Press ⇒Key

If one or more faults are stored:

The faults stored will be displayed and printed out one after the other.

 
→ Then the display will show:
Rapid data transfer     HELP
Select function XX
  • ‒ Locate and eliminate faults printed out as per fault table => Page 01-10 .
  • ‒ Input 05 for "Erase fault memory" function and confirm with Q.
 
→ Indicated on display:
Rapid data transfer     ⇒
Fault memory is erased

Note:

If the ignition is switched off between interrogating fault memory and erasing fault memory, the fault memory will not be erased.

  • ‒ Press ⇒Key
 
→ Indicated on display:
Rapid data transfer     HELP
Select function XX
  • ‒ Input 06 for "End output" function and confirm with Q.

Note:

If a fault is present which is not recognised by the self diagnosis, carry out further fault finding using the fault table in "Engine fault finding" binder.
